Library Holds Chromebook Giveaway to Eligible Families

June 29, 2023 | By Baltimore County Public Library

We believe that access to technology is one key to achieving economic freedom and accessing important educational opportunities. As part of our strategic plan, we are helping close the digital divide in Baltimore County. Through a grant provided by Baltimore County via the Maryland State Department of Housing and Community Development, we are proud to be joining other County agencies in a free Chromebook giveaway for eligible Baltimore County households. Distribution events are held at branches and community sites throughout the county between July 12 and November 21.

Those eligible should register for one of the timeslots at least 24 hours before an event. A limited number of walk-up appointments are available. If all timeslots get filled, you are encouraged to call the Digital Equity and Virtual Services (DEVS) department at 410-887-6124. All qualifying documentation needs to be provided at pickup whether scheduled or walk-in. Each appointment is roughly 15 minutes but wait times may vary at each branch. Digital Navigators are also available at each event to help customers log on to their new Chromebook, learn about the Affordable Connectivity Program (ACP) and receive resources on tech basics to get started.

How to Qualify

One Chromebook may go to each household/address if the resident is 18 years old or older, a Baltimore County resident and participates in one of the following programs: 

  • Child receives free or reduced lunches at Baltimore County Public Schools
  • Federal Housing Benefits
  • Federal Pell Grant
  • Income below the 200 percent Federal Poverty Level
  • Medicaid 
  • SNAP 
  • SSI
  • Veteran’s Pension or Survivor Benefits
  • WIC 

What to Bring

Customers need to bring something to verify their identity (driver’s license or other government ID), something to confirm their place of Baltimore County residence and documentation for any of the programs listed above.

If You Don’t Receive a Chromebook 

We understand that demand may be higher than our supply of Chromebooks. If you don’t receive a laptop at one of our events, we encourage you to check out our long-term lending program. Qualified customers can borrow a Wi-Fi enabled Chromebook or a high-speed 5G LTE internet router, or both, for up to six months. Our Library of Things also features Chromebooks and Hotspots for a normal borrowing period of 21 days with a library card.
